Essential Duties & Responsibilities
Conduct nursing assessments and monitor clients throughout the overnight shift.
Administer medications safely, accurately, and in accordance with physician orders.
Monitor and manage withdrawal symptoms using established detoxification protocols.
Complete COWS and CIWA assessments per clinical protocol.
Educate clients on medications, treatment plans, and the recovery process.
Coordinate with on-call medical providers regarding client assessments, medication needs, and changes in condition.
Respond appropriately to medical and behavioral health emergencies using sound clinical judgment.
Utilize strong de-escalation techniques to maintain a safe, therapeutic environment for clients and staff.
Maintain accurate, timely, and thorough clinical documentation.
Ensure medical equipment and supplies are maintained and functioning properly.
Complete all required trainings, certifications, and continuing education requirements.
Perform other duties as assigned.
